Word:
FJ
Definition:
Finger jointed.
A method of joining smaller pieces of wood together to create longer lengths. Finger joints are very strong and the wood has a lesser chance of warping than a single piece of wood the same length.
Finger joint; end-jointed lumber using finger-joint configuration
A series of fingers machined on the ends of two pieces of wood to be joined, which mesh together and are held firmly in position with an adhesive.
